首页
学习
活动
专区
工具
TVP
发布
社区首页 >问答首页 >将材质设计图标导入android项目

将材质设计图标导入android项目
EN

Stack Overflow用户
提问于 2015-02-24 06:29:22
回答 4查看 103.2K关注 0票数 167

有没有一种简单的方法可以将Material Design icons存储库的所有图标导入到android项目中,而不需要手动操作?

EN

回答 4

Stack Overflow用户

发布于 2019-06-15 23:46:39

在folder drawable > right click > new > vector asset上,然后单击图标:

票数 28
EN

Stack Overflow用户

发布于 2015-02-27 21:14:25

你可以使用这个新的android studio Android Material Design Icon Generator Plugin插件来帮助你使用谷歌提供的这些材料图标:Google material-design-icons

票数 23
EN

Stack Overflow用户

发布于 2016-06-04 13:22:29

这是一个克隆github材料设计图标存储库的脚本,地址为

https://github.com/google/material-design-icons

并创建所有文件的索引。它还按类别将svg文件复制到子目录。你可以以此为基础将你感兴趣的文件复制到你的项目中--只需根据你的喜好修改find和cp copy语句。例如,如果您需要特定大小的png-它们位于相邻目录中,那么您需要相应地修改find和copy命令。

代码语言:javascript
复制
#!/bin/bash
# WF 2016-06-04
# get google material design icons
# see http://stackoverflow.com/questions/28684759/import-material-design-icons-into-an-android-project
tmp=/tmp/icons
index=$tmp/index.html
mkdir -p $tmp
cd $tmp
if [ ! -d material-design-icons ]
then
  git clone https://github.com/google/material-design-icons
fi
cat << EOF > $index
<html>
  <head>
    <head>
    <body>
      <h1>Google Material Design Icons</h1>
EOF
for icon in `find . -name *.svg | grep production | grep 48`
do
    svg=`basename $icon .svg`
    category=`echo $icon | cut -f3 -d '/'`
    echo $category $svg.svg
    mkdir -p $tmp/$category
    cp $icon $tmp/$category
    echo "    <img src='"$icon"' title='"$category $svg"' >" >> $index
done
cat << EOF >> $index
  </body>
</html>
EOF
票数 7
EN
页面原文内容由Stack Overflow提供。腾讯云小微IT领域专用引擎提供翻译支持
原文链接:

https://stackoverflow.com/questions/28684759

复制
相关文章

相似问题

领券
问题归档专栏文章快讯文章归档关键词归档开发者手册归档开发者手册 Section 归档